Transaction 5358a7fa978769361e687af7b91d59625d189a02def26f1fde20c5631e385b54
1 Input
1 Output
-
5358a7fa978769361e687af7b91d59625d189a02def26f1fde20c5631e385b54:0
- value
- 335280151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 655d687c9b22e4b3237ec7f92b0dbdf564442958 OP_EQUAL
- address
- MH98Nv9hKsANWUg9rPRCV7aTLfK1R821Uw